Allegro MicroSystems ARG81402 Multi-Output Regulator
Allegro MicroSystems ARG81402 Multi-Output Regulator permits power to loads such as microprocessors, sensors, and communication transceivers and is ideal for both automotive and industrial applications. The ARG81402 is highly integrated with a synchronous buck 5.35V pre-regulator, five LDO outputs, a configurable watchdog, and dedicated pins for a power-on reset output (NPOR). Furthermore, the device provides a self-generated Safe State output and a fault flag output to alert the microprocessor that a fault has occurred.The Allegro MicroSystems ARG81402 Multi-Output Regulator is housed in a low-profile 32-lead, 5mm × 5mm, 0.5mm pitch QFN package (suffix “ET”) with an exposed thermal pad and wettable flank to allow solder joint inspection.
Features
- Control and diagnostic reporting through a serial peripheral interface (SPI)
- Wide input voltage range (6VIN to 36VIN operating range, 40VIN maximum)
- 2.2MHz Synchronous buck 5.35V pre-regulator (VREG) for integration and efficiency
- Five internal linear regulators with foldback short-circuit protection
- 3.3V and 4 x 5V outputs (one with short- to-battery protection for remote sensors)
- OV and UV protection for all output rails provide the ability to monitor the health of outputs
- Pin-to-pin and pin-to-ground tolerant at every pin
- Three configurable watchdogs with fail-safe features pulse period, window, Q&A watchdog
- Power-on reset signal (NPOR) indicating a fault on the 3.3V output, the optional 1.3V input monitor (for self-powered core voltage) and a watchdog failure
- Safety signal (POE) can disable a separate function (e.g., Motor Driver) due to a watchdog failure

- 5mm × 5mm eQFN wettable flank package for small solution size, good thermals, and guaranteed solder fillet
Applications
- Provides system power (for microcontroller/DSP, CAN, sensors, etc.) in:
- Industrial applications
- Electronic power steering (EPS)
- Advanced braking systems (ABS)
- Transmission control units (TCU)
- Emissions control modules
- Other automotive applications
